A video of USMNT care packages, containing jerseys and other FIFA World Cup memorabilia, aboard American Airlines’ flights to Seattle has emerged on social media.
The 2026 World Cup is the second edition of the tournament, after 1994, to be hosted by the USA. While the 1994 edition was held completely within the States, they are co-hosting the 2026 edition alongside Canada and Mexico.

The USMNT won their opening game of the 2026 FIFA World Cup against Paraguay at the Los Angeles Stadium in Inglewood on Friday, June 12. An own goal from Damian Bobadilla (7′), a brace from Folarin Balogun (31′, 45+5′) and a stunner from Gio Reyna (90+8′) secured a 4-1 win for the Stars and Stripes.
Their second fixture of Group D will be against Australia at the Seattle Stadium on Friday, June 19. Ahead of the game, people flying to the city in Washington State via American Airlines have been given a surprise package aboard their flights.
As seen in the clip below, the airline placed a USMNT jersey on the backrest of every single seat on the plane. A gift hamper containing other memorabilia, such as a replica of the official Trionda football, customized pouches and posters among others, were also kept on every seat.
The USMNT, led by stars like Balogun, Christian Pulisic, Weston McKennie and Tyler Adams, will be hoping to make a deep run in the 2026 FIFA World Cup. Besides Australia, they will face off against Turkiye (June 25) in the group stage of the competition.
“We should dream without limits” – USMNT coach Mauricio Pochettino gives motivational message to his side at 2026 FIFA World Cup
USMNT boss Mauricio Pochettino has claimed that his side ‘should dream without limits’ at the 2026 FIFA World Cup.
The Stars and Stripes’ best-ever World Cup result came at the first ever edition of the competition (1930), in which they won the bronze medal. Since then, they have qualified for another 10 editions of the tournament, with their quarter-final run in 2002 being their best result.
After a 4-1 thumping of Paraguay (June 12) in their opening encounter of the 2026 World Cup, the USA fans will be hoping for a dream run on home soil. In an interview with The Athletic (via GOAL), Pochettino has urged his side to aim high and keep the dream alive.
The Argentine tactician said:
“The Paraguay game showed that the talent exists. When resources are distributed and the balance of power is leveled out, we are a very strong force… We should dream without limits.”
A win against Australia (June 19) would ensure that the USMNT finish atop Group D and qualify for the Round of 32 at the 2026 FIFA World Cup.
